In the fast-evolving landscape of urban living, apartment dwellers are continually seeking innovative ways to optimize their limited spaces. A key piece of furniture that can transform a living area is the coffee table, which not only serves practical purposes but also acts as a decorative centerpiece. According to a recent report by the American Home Furnishings Alliance, compact and multi-functional furniture is among the top trends in interior design for 2023, particularly in urban environments where every square inch counts.
Coffee tables designed with apartment living in mind often feature stylish designs that incorporate storage solutions. For instance, tables with built-in shelves or drawers allow residents to stow away books, remote controls, and other essentials, thus maintaining a clutter-free space. A survey conducted by Statista indicates that 63% of homeowners prioritize functionality over aesthetics in furniture choices. Therefore, coffee tables that blend practicality with elegant design are increasingly appealing.
Versatility is another essential consideration for apartment coffee tables. Designs that can easily transition from a coffee table to a dining surface, or even a workspace, meet the demands of modern living. As urban living spaces become more adaptable, the role of the coffee table expands, reflecting current trends in functional design.
